Time of Update: 2017-01-13
用法int fsockopen(string hostname, int port, int [errno], string [errstr], int [timeout]);一個採集網頁執行個體 代碼如下複製代碼 <?phpfunction get_url ($url,$cookie=false){$url = parse_url($url);$query = $url[path].”?”.$url[query];echo
Time of Update: 2017-01-13
代碼如下複製代碼 <form action=”upload.php” method=”post” enctype=”multipart/form-data”><p><input type=”file” name=”pictures[]” /><br /><input
Time of Update: 2017-01-13
從5.2開始APC加入了一個叫APC_UPLOAD_PROGRESS的東東,解決了困擾大家已久的進度條問題。並且它把原來的上傳時把臨時檔案全部緩衝到記憶體改成了當臨時檔案達到設定值時就自動儲存到硬碟,有效地改善了記憶體利用狀況。它的作用原理是在上傳時候賦予每個上傳一個唯一的ID,當 PHP 指令碼收到一個上傳檔案時,解釋程式將自動檢查 $_POST數組中名為 APC_UPLOAD_PROGRESS
Time of Update: 2017-01-13
代碼如下複製代碼 <?php$cates = array( array( 'cid' => 1, 'cname' => '新聞', 'pid' => 0 ), array( 'cid' => 2, 'cname' =>
Time of Update: 2017-01-13
方法一 這種產生就是一個二維碼中間不帶圖片的,直接調用google的一個功能就實現了。 代碼如下複製代碼 $urlToEncode="http://gz.altmi.com"; generateQRfromGoogle($urlToEncode); function generateQRfromGoogle($chl,$widhtHeight ='150',$EC_level='L',$margin='0') {
Time of Update: 2017-01-13
代碼如下複製代碼 例<?php$limit = array( //gb2312 拼音排序 array(45217,45252), //A array(45253,45760), //B array(45761,46317), //C array(46318,46825), //D array(4
Time of Update: 2017-01-13
include()產生一個警告而require()則導致一個致命錯誤。換句話說,如果想在遇到丟失檔案時停止處理頁面就用require()。include()就不是這樣,指令碼會繼續運行。同時也要確認設定了合適的include_path。注意在 PHP 4.3.5之前,包含檔案中的語法錯誤不會導致程式停止,但從此版本之後會關於include require
Time of Update: 2017-01-13
串連資料庫 代碼如下複製代碼 $memcache_obj = memcache_connect(”localhost”, 11211);memcache_add($memcache_obj, ’var_key’, ’test variable’, false, 30);$memcache_obj->add(’var_key’, ’test
Time of Update: 2017-01-13
一、嘗試過的URL跳轉方法 代碼如下複製代碼 echo '<meta http-equiv="refresh" content="0; URL='.$url.'">';echo '<scrīpt language="Javascrīpt">window.location.href="'.$url.'";</scrīpt>';echo '<script
Time of Update: 2017-01-13
測試程式如下://說明1:由於讀資料庫語句調用簡單的封包函數兩次,所以把讀檔案也改成連續調用兩次,資料庫記錄ID為1就在第一條,並且唯一索引。 代碼如下複製代碼 //說明2:測試兩次一次是4K資料,一次是整形資料set_time_limit(0);function fnGet($filename){ $content = file_get_contents($filename); return
Time of Update: 2017-01-13
例如:下載時輸出 下載檔案大小,檔案名稱等等 前提是.htaccess檔案的配置需要添加一句 SetEnv no-gzip dont-vary 就是針對檔案不進行壓縮處理例1 代碼如下複製代碼 <?php function download($file_dir,$file_name) //參數說明: //file_dir:檔案所在目錄 //file_name:檔案名稱 { $file_dir = chop($file_dir);//去掉路徑中多餘的空格 //
Time of Update: 2017-01-13
最簡單的執行個體如下 代碼如下複製代碼 <form action="" method="post" enctype="multipart/form-data"><p>Pictures:<input type="file" name="pictures[]" /><input type="file"
Time of Update: 2017-01-13
代碼如下複製代碼 <?phpclass Code{// 1. 定義各個成員 有寬、高、畫布、字數、類型、畫類型private $width; //寬度private $height; //高度private $num; //驗證碼字數private $imgType; //產生圖片類型private $Type; //字串類型 1,2,3 三個選項 1 純數字 2 純小寫字母 3 大小寫數字混合private $hb; //畫布public $codestr; //
Time of Update: 2017-01-13
例1 代碼如下複製代碼 /**功能:php多種方式完美實現下載遠程圖片儲存到本地*參數:檔案url,儲存檔案名稱,使用的下載方式*當儲存檔案名稱為空白時則使用遠程檔案原來的名稱*/function getImage($url,$filename='',$type=0){ if($url==''){return false;}
Time of Update: 2017-01-13
注意:curl函數在php中預設是不被支援的,如果需要使用curl函數我們需在改一改你的php.ini檔案的設定,找到php_curl.dll去掉前面的";"就行了例1 代碼如下複製代碼 <?php$uri = "http://tanteng.duapp.com/test.php";// 參數數組$data = array ( 'name'
Time of Update: 2017-01-13
代碼如下複製代碼 $url = "http://www.111cn.net/ login"; <!--?xml version="1.0"?--> $ch = curl_init(); $header[] = "Content-type: text/xml";//定義content-type為xml curl_setopt($ch, CURLOPT_URL, $url);
Time of Update: 2017-01-13
匯出Excel用法//設定環境變數(新增PHPExcel) 代碼如下複製代碼 set_include_path('.'. PATH_SEPARATOR . Yii::app()->basePath.'/lib/PHPExcel' . PATH_SEPARATOR .get_include_path());
Time of Update: 2017-01-13
遇Drupal網站運行時因為記憶體過大導航記憶體溢出的情況時,百度基本就能解決掉問題。但是搜尋來的結果往往要不就是繁瑣不堪,要不就是適用性差,並不能很好的解決drupal中的php記憶體不夠的問題。莫慌,今天教給大家的便是用最簡潔的方法來修改drupal運行時的php記憶體。找到settings.php這個檔案,它通常存在於你的sites/default/目錄下,倘若你沒有做修改的話。通過Ctrl+F找到“PHP
Time of Update: 2017-01-13
如何在phpcms的模板檔案template中使用php語言?有兩種方式,一是phpcms提供的標籤,一是直接寫原生php語句。1.phpcms提供的標籤{php $i=10;}{php $i++;}{php echo func(2);}使用{php
Time of Update: 2017-01-13
在動態網面設計中很多都要涉及到對資料庫的操作,但是有時跟據需要而改用其它後台資料庫,就需要大量修改程式。這是一件枯燥、費時而且容易出錯的功作。其實我們可以用PHP中的類來實現對資料庫操作的封裝,從而使寫出的程式在很小的改動下就可以完成後台資料庫的更改。 現在我們把其封裝在dbfz.inc中,其設計如下: class dbInterface{ var $dbID=1; //用於確定當前操作的資料庫,當dbID為1代表MySql,當為 2代表 SQL